Rogge Dunn Group is representing Ricky Riggs, former president of Future Infrastructure LLC, in a lawsuit alleging a confidentiality breach in which that the company unlawfully accessed and misused private, privileged information shared between Riggs and his attorney. The suit claims that Future Infrastructure’s leadership used third-party portals to obtain protected documents—outside the company’s server environment—and relied on this confidential information as the basis to terminate Riggs and pursue litigation against him. “This case will test the boundaries of employee privacy rights,” said Rogge Dunn. “Employers cannot weaponize privileged communications to retaliate against an employee.” The outcome could have significant implications for employee privacy protections in Texas and across the country.
